Answer DNs and Answer keys

If you have Answer DNs assigned to memory buttons with displays, you
can use an Answer DN button to monitor calls on another telephone. The
calls that come to the monitored telephone that provide an appearance on
the Answer DN button are determined by the system-wide Anskey setting.
Answer buttons are useful for attendants who monitor incoming calls for
one or several other people. For example, a secretary may have
appearances for three different bosses on her answer buttons. Once a call
for boss A is answered by the secretary, the appearance stops at that
telephone. This allows for another, simultaneous call to come in on the
same line. The same is true for boss B and boss C. When incoming call
traffic becomes high, the calls can then be routed to a Hunt Group to
optimize call handling. For more information about Hunt Groups, see
''Programming Hunt Groups'' on page 165.
Systems running CICS 7.0 and newer software can also use an Answer DN
button to auto dial the telephone. The Answer DN must be idle (no
indicator) for this feature to work. This feature does not prevent you from
assigning a memory button as an auto dial button for the same DN.
Digital Mobility phones, and the 7000 and 7100 digital phones, can also
have Answer DNs assigned. However, since these telephones do not have,
or do not have enough, memory buttons with display keys, the Answer DN
must be set to Ring Only. These telephones also only have two assigned
intercom buttons, therefore, a maximum of two Answer DNs can be
answered and active at the same time.
Answer DNs are assigned under Terminals&Sets under Lines, Line
Assgn. This setting assigns the DN of another telephone to one of your
telephone buttons.
Answer keys are assigned under System prgrming, Featr settings.
This setting determines which calls will appear at the bottom. There are
three levels: Basic, Enhanced, and Extended.
You need an Installer password to perform this programming. See the
Compact ICS 7.1 Installer Guide for more information.
ISDN terminals cannot be assigned Answer buttons to monitor other
sets, but they can be monitored.
You cannot make calls using Answer buttons.
